Rossiter still grounded as Robins star on screen again

8:00am Tuesday 29th April 2008

By Gareth Moorhouse

ALUN Rossiter has banned all talk of an Elite League title charge this season, despite watching his Robins open up a six-point lead at the summit with a crushing 56-37 win over Eastbourne Eagles.

The Sky Sports cameras were at the Abbey Stadium to capture Robins most convincing win of the campaign to date, in a meeting Rossiter had predicted would be Swindon's "sternest test yet."

But the Blunsdon chief has his feet firmly on the ground - for now.

Rosco said: "These boys are full of confidence and they should be after tonight, because they have performed brilliantly.

"But there will be no talk of winning the league.

"It's early days yet and we just have to keep plugging away and stay injury free.

"If we go down to Eastbourne and win on Saturday, then maybe people will really start to think about us as contenders.

"We believe we can win down there, but they will be fired up. It should make for some great racing."
